Essential Advice for DIY Home Improvement Projects: A Painter's Guide pointers
Embarking on a DIY home improvement project can be both rewarding and daunting. Before you grab your brushes and paint, consider these essential tips to ensure a smooth and successful painting experience.
- Thoroughly prepare your surfaces by cleaning, patching any issues, and sanding for a uniform finish.
- Opt the right type of paint for your project. Consider factors like longevity and desired appearance.
- Apply paint in thin, even layers to avoid drips and ensure proper coverage. Allow each layer to cure completely before applying the next.
- Invest in quality brushes and rollers for a professional application. Clean them completely after use to extend their lifespan.
Bear in mind that proper ventilation is crucial while painting. Wear protective gear such as gloves and a mask to shield yourself from fumes and splatters.
Masterful Paint Application: Achieving a Smooth and Durable Coat
Achieving a perfect paint outcome requires more than just slapping on some shade. It demands precision, technique, and an understanding of the materials you're working with. Firstly, proper surface preparation is paramount. This comprises thoroughly cleaning, sanding, and priming your surface to create a foundation that will ensure your paint attaches properly.
, Subsequently, selecting the appropriate type of paint for your project is crucial. Consider the setting where it will be applied and the intended toughness. Latex paints are popular for their ease of cleaning and quick drying time, while oil-based paints offer greater protection. Once you have your paint, harness the ideal application techniques.
Employ a quality brush or roller and apply the paint in thin, even coats. Allow each coat to cure completely before applying the next. This will prevent runs and ensure a seamless outcome.
Finally, remember that patience is key. Rushing through the process can lead to an unsatisfactory result. Take your time, pay attention to detail, and you'll be rewarded with a professional-looking paint job that will last for years to come.
